AR constable suspended

May 16, 2018 12:03 am | Updated 12:03 am IST - KHAMMAM

Ramu, an Armed Reserve (AR) constable deputed as a driver in the AR unit’s Motor Transport section here has been placed under suspension for alleged negligence in shifting victims of a road accident to hospital.

The accident occurred at Chenjerla in Manakondur mandal of Karimnagar district on Friday when a police vehicle collided with a car resulting in injuries to a couple travelling in it. Three cops on board the police vehicle also sustained injuries.

The constable, who was returning to Khammam in a separate police vehicle carrying policemen after attending a VIP bandobust duty in Karimnagar district, came across the accident sitea few minutes later the same day. He allegedly failed to respond promptly in shifting the injured from the accident spot to a nearby hospital, sources said.

Khammam Police Commissioner Tafseer Iqbal on Tuesday issued orders for his suspension the cop on charge of alleged dereliction of duty.
